Their melting points vary. Obviously ... WebHigh Melting and Boiling Points As a result of powerful metallic bonding, the attractive force between the metal atoms is quite strong. In order to overcome this force of attraction, a great deal of energy is required. This is the reason why metals tend to have high melting and boiling points. stylus pen tip material

When the liquid is at high pressure, it has a higher boiling point than the boiling point at normal … WebMetals have a broad range of melting points throughout the periodic table. Tungsten melts at 3422°C, whereas Caesium melts at 28°C. Separating metal atoms from one another requires a certain amount of energy. The bigger the atom, the greater the distance between neighbouring atoms in a metal crystal.
